Beyoncé has been named a billionaire by Forbes, becoming the fifth musician listed among the world's wealthiest people by the publication. This follows Forbes' earlier estimate of her net worth at about $800 million. Jay-Z, her husband, is listed at $2.5 billion by Forbes.

Beyoncé's rise to billionaire status is attributed to several recent successful ventures. The Renaissance World Tour in 2023 grossed nearly $600 million, demonstrating her continued appeal as a live performer. She also produced a concert film that was released through an AMC deal, earning nearly half of the film's $44 million global box office.

In 2024, Beyoncé's album "Cowboy Carter" won the Grammy Award for Album of the Year, marking her first win after four prior nominations. The accompanying Cowboy Carter tour earned over $400 million in ticket sales and approximately $50 million in merchandise revenue. The tour featured performances by Jay-Z, two of their three children, and former Destiny's Child members. It set ticket price records in the United Kingdom, with top-priced tickets reaching £950 and the cheapest tickets at £71. Notable venues included Tottenham Hotspur Stadium in London and Stade de France in Paris.

Additionally, Beyoncé generated about $50 million from Netflix's Christmas Day NFL halftime show, along with an extra $10 million from Levi's commercials.

While Forbes recognizes Beyoncé as a billionaire, there is a discrepancy regarding Selena Gomez’s net worth. Bloomberg's billionaire index estimates Gomez at about $1.3 billion in 2024, but Forbes disputes this, estimating her wealth at $700 million.
